Transaction fac5ce966037908852b7d82169ddcde603f433ed1e891173244625a043c66462
1 Input
1 Output
-
fac5ce966037908852b7d82169ddcde603f433ed1e891173244625a043c66462:0
- value
- 298477
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09cabc07d55a18917bef4130ef43cbb60b2dc3dc OP_EQUAL
- address
- 32ansWXQdzrtniJttpw2Qviwzy5QbnKnzz